Conserving Evidence

In the event of a car accident, the evidence that you have will greatly increase the chances of obtaining settlement and recovering damages. It is essential to preserve and protect any evidence that you might have after an accident.

It's easier than ever to accomplish this thanks to modern technology. Your smartphone can be used to snap high-quality photos and videos of the scene of the crash. These tools can assist you to record important evidence that would otherwise be lost or destroyed.

The crash site itself as well as witnesses are among the most important pieces of evidence. Ideally, you should make an effort to photograph the accident scene in the exact condition it was at following the collision. This includes all the vehicles involved in a crash as well as any skidmarks or marks on the road, the weather conditions or traffic signs, and other important factors.

You may also want to contact nearby businesses to ask them to save any evidence that could be relevant to your case. If you were struck by a truck and asked that its black box be preserved this could be beneficial to your case.

If you suspect that the other driver was under the influence or negligent, requesting their drug tests could also be helpful in your case. The tests could prove that the driver was intoxicated or distracted and could be a strong indicator of their negligence in creating an accident.

Documenting Your Injury

Documentation is essential in personal injury cases. Not only does this ensure that your healthcare provider is aware of your condition and symptoms, but it can also aid your attorney in proving your damages and losses when filing a claim against the party responsible for negligence.

One of the most important types of documentation is medical records. Whenever you visit your doctor for treatment following an accident, make sure you be given copies of every document. These records are used to detail your injuries, symptoms and diagnoses. These documents will also document the expenses you have incurred because of your accident. This is important because a large portion of these expenses are reimbursable as part of your compensation claim.

Keep a diary of your physical and mental state after the incident. This should include the type of pain you feel, where it occurs, and how long it lasts. It is also essential to record any mental trauma that you may be experiencing, as juries often decide to award damages that are not economic in kind of case.

It is also helpful to take photos of your injuries and the scene of the crash when you are able. You can also take pictures of the vehicle you're driving, any other vehicles that were involved in the collision or any other damage to objects (such an object, a building, or a sign). It is recommended to take several photos of each item from various angles and distances to ensure that investigators are able to clearly discern the root cause.

Collecting Witness Statements

In an ideal world, witness statements would be collected in the shortest time possible following an accident. It's important to remember that memories fade with time, so it's important for witnesses to provide their statements as soon as possible. The more detailed a statement is, the more detailed. It is also recommended to record any interview with witnesses (with their consent of course) because this will help ensure that the witness's account is accurate.

It is also worthwhile to look for witnesses outside of the immediate area of your crash. You could ask local business owners if they witnessed your accident. You should also ensure that any statements made by potential witnesses do not contain thoughts, feelings or speculations about the outcome of the accident or feelings of sympathy for you or any other victims. These statements can be damaging to your credibility, particularly if they're contradicted by another witness. Avoid asking for statements from anyone who knows the person at responsible for your injuries or has any connection to their employer, since they may attempt to influence your claim in favor of the company they represent. If this is the case, you might not be able get the compensation you need.
